#078ff6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#078ff6 is composed of 2.7% red, 56.1%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 41.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 205.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 49.6%. #078ff6 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effff with #001fed.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

Shades and Tints of #078ff6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a11 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#078ff6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7f81 is the less saturated color, while #078ff6 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#078ff6 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#727272 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#5d788c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#618ff1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#1f94f6 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#00a0aa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#408ff3 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1692f6 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#029ac5 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
